If it’s a quarantine. I would not personally plumb it directly to the system. Even with a sterilizer. I would not trust it. However. If you want the main system water (and I understand why you would want that) the only safe way is a separate pump feeding the frag tank that has flow less than the...
My concern would be what is the non pressurized flow thru the UV. Slower is better in the sterilizer but it needs to be greater then flow into the frag tank. I would think a dedicated pumped loop is the only safe way to go unless you have a secondary overflow from frag to sump.
